1- Defining the Idea and Concept Design

Every development journey starts with a new idea. This idea may arise from an urgent need to solve a particular problem faced by a company or from an innovative vision to enhance existing services or products. At this stage, thorough research must be conducted to understand the target market and identify the needs of end users. This research should be backed by reliable data and an in-depth analysis of current and future trends.

Once the necessary information is gathered, these insights are translated into an initial concept for the digital solution. This concept should be clear and tangible enough to be presented to all stakeholders to align the vision and ensure goal alignment.

 

2- Project Planning and Strategy Development

After defining the core idea, the next step is strategic planning. This involves creating a detailed project roadmap covering all aspects, including objectives, scope of work, timelines, and task distribution among team members. It is also essential to determine the technology stack to be used and how the new solution will integrate with existing systems.

The strategy should be flexible and adaptable to any changes that may arise during the development process. Good planning at this stage can be the determining factor between project success and failure.

 

3- Prototyping and Initial Testing

The next phase involves prototyping, where the conceptual idea is transformed into something tangible and visual. Prototypes can range from wireframes to interactive models that allow stakeholders to explore how the solution will function in practice.

Prototyping is a crucial tool for testing assumptions and making necessary adjustments before full-scale development begins.

By working on prototypes, designers and developers can gather early feedback from users and stakeholders, reducing risks and increasing the chances of success.

 

4- Development Process Begins

Once the initial design phase is completed and approved by all relevant parties, the actual development process begins. At this stage, prototypes are translated into functional code and efficient interfaces across various devices and platforms. Collaboration between design and development teams is essential to ensure all project components align with the original vision.

Development should be carried out gradually and systematically to prevent deviations from the set plan. Agile methodologies can be particularly beneficial in maintaining continuous progress.

 

5- Testing and Optimization

After development, the testing phase begins, involving rigorous tests to verify the solution’s performance and eliminate potential issues. This phase includes testing all functionalities, from performance and security to usability.

Test results are not the final step but rather a key to identifying areas that need improvement or additional refinement.

 

6- Deployment and Launch

Once the solution is fully prepared, it is deployed and launched for users. This may require training sessions for users on how to operate the new system, as well as comprehensive documentation for technical support.

A dedicated support team should be available to address any issues that arise post-launch. Successful deployment requires effective coordination among all stakeholders to ensure seamless user experience.

 

7- Continuous Monitoring and Improvement

After launch, ongoing monitoring is essential to ensure that the digital solution continues to meet customer needs effectively. User feedback analysis helps identify opportunities for continuous updates and enhancements, keeping the solution competitive and aligned with evolving market demands and customer expectations.
